The use for the competition theory of the industrial investment decisions—a case study of the Taiwan IC assembly industry

Hsi-che Teng and Ying-fang Huang

International Journal of Production Economics, 2013, vol. 141, issue 1, 335-338

Abstract: This study empirically analyzes model accuracy, and applies grey forecasting to handle non-linear problems, insufficient data resources and forecasting involving small samples, and to construct the co-opetition diffusion model for the Lotka–Volterra (L.V.) system. Furthermore, this study examines historical data comprising revenue trends in the Taiwanese IC assembly industry during the past ten years and selects from a range of forecasting models.
